M. Basketball. Hilltoppers Return to Action at Indiana State

BOWLING GREEN, Ky. — WKU Hilltopper Basketball heads into the final stretch of a seven-game road swing with a trip to face Indiana State at 3:30 p.m. CT Sunday in Terre Haute, Ind.

The Hilltoppers (3-5) are coming off four straight losses at Missouri, Eastern Kentucky, UNLV and Washington to start the road swing.
